James Earl Shipman - February 13, 1918- July 4th, 2011 Jim a Normandy survivor and decorated WWII Veteran serving under General Patton, Pioneer of Hollywood, and Free and Accepted Mason, died peacefully surrounded by his family on July 4th at the age of 93. Born in Double Springs, AL, Jimmy migrated to Hollywood as a young man where he would meet his beloved wife, of 64 years. Remembered as a proud solider, a charismatic and charming man and wonderful Husband, Father and Grandfather. He is survived and will be deeply missed by wife, Eloise, children Diane and Wayne, grandson, Michael and loving extended family.
